The internet is an excellent classroom but a poor crawl-space diagnostician — it explains the concepts, but it can’t diagnose your specific home.
It can show you what a vapor barrier looks like, explain why wood moisture matters, and help you recognize the language in a repair proposal. It cannot measure your floor framing, trace water back to its source, or decide whether the expensive solution in a video belongs under your home.
That distinction matters. A homeowner who understands the basics can ask sharper questions and reject vague sales claims. A homeowner who mistakes general information for a property-specific diagnosis can spend thousands treating the wrong problem.
Can online research diagnose a crawl space?
No. Online research can identify possibilities, but a crawl-space diagnosis must connect observed evidence to a likely cause. A search result sees the symptom you typed. It does not see the foundation grade, downspout discharge, plumbing, ductwork, soil, piers, joists, insulation, or history of the house.
Use the internet to learn four useful things:
- Vocabulary: vapor barrier, efflorescence, relative humidity, wood moisture content, drainage, encapsulation, dehumidification, and structural support.
- Common causes: roof runoff, grading, groundwater, plumbing leaks, soil vapor, humid outdoor air, duct condensation, and incomplete repairs.
- Repair categories: water management, vapor control, air sealing, drying, insulation, framing repair, and ongoing monitoring.
- Better questions: what was measured, what caused the condition, what is urgent, what can wait, and what result the proposed work should produce.
Then stop. Those categories are a map of possibilities, not proof of what your home needs.
Why can two similar Raleigh homes have different crawl-space problems?
Because water and moisture follow the conditions around each individual structure. Two homes built by the same company on the same street may have different lot elevations, drainage history, gutter discharge, plumbing repairs, duct layouts, sun exposure, additions, or vapor-barrier coverage.
One crawl space may stay dry during a storm while the next receives runoff from a low corner of the yard. One may have condensation on uninsulated ductwork while another has a slow plumbing leak. A photograph of dark wood or fallen insulation does not reveal which path created the condition.
NC State Extension's homeowner maintenance guidance tells North Carolina homeowners to keep runoff from pooling near the foundation, examine foundation walls for dampness, and check that the crawl-space vapor barrier is correctly placed and in good condition. Those are separate observations because moisture rarely has only one possible entry path.
What can photos, videos, and AI miss?
They can miss anything outside the frame and anything that requires touch, measurement, history, or context. A clear photo can document a condition, but it cannot reliably establish how wet the wood is, whether it is soft, when the condition occurs, or whether the visible area represents the rest of the crawl space.
An on-site assessment can compare evidence that does not travel well through a screen:
- moisture readings in multiple framing locations, not one convenient spot;
- the relationship between exterior grade, gutters, downspouts, foundation openings, and interior water patterns;
- the condition of joists, girders, piers, supports, insulation, ducts, plumbing, and the vapor barrier;
- whether an odor, stain, salt deposit, or damaged material is consistent with the proposed cause;
- which conditions are active now and which appear to be evidence of an older event.
The U.S. Environmental Protection Agency's guidance on finding mold and moisture recommends including crawl spaces in a building examination when possible and investigating musty odors and past water events. It also warns that some white material may be alkaline salts rather than mold. That is a useful example of why visual resemblance alone is not enough.
Why do crawl-space companies recommend different repairs?
Different proposals may reflect different evidence, different priorities, or simply different products that each company is organized to sell. A waterproofing company may lead with drainage. An encapsulation company may lead with a liner and dehumidifier. A structural contractor may focus on framing and supports.
Specialization is not automatically dishonest, and the highest or lowest price is not automatically right. The real comparison is between the reasoning behind each scope:
- Observed condition: What exactly did the person see or measure?
- Likely cause: How does that evidence support the explanation?
- Priority: What happens if the work is delayed?
- Scope: Which items address the cause, and which are upgrades or preferences?
- Expected result: How will the homeowner know the work succeeded?
Discarding the high and low bids and choosing the middle does not answer any of those questions. It only chooses the middle price.
How should homeowners use internet research before an assessment?
Use it to prepare and verify—not to prescribe. A practical research process looks like this:
- Write down the symptom and timing. Note odors, water, floor movement, humidity, stains, or insulation problems and whether they change after rain or during cooling season.
- Photograph safely from accessible areas. Do not enter a flooded, electrically unsafe, structurally questionable, or extremely confined space.
- Learn the repair categories. Understand the difference between controlling bulk water, ground vapor, humid air, plumbing leaks, and structural damage.
- Read sources that explain principles. Government and university building guidance is more useful for fundamentals than a page built only to sell one system.
- Bring questions to the assessment. Ask the consultant to connect each recommendation to visible evidence or a measurement.
The U.S. Department of Energy's Building Science Education guidance on crawl-space ground barriers, for example, explains how soil moisture can migrate as liquid water or vapor and why a continuous barrier matters. That principle is valuable. Whether your home also needs drainage changes, air sealing, drying equipment, or framing work is a separate diagnosis.
What should an independent crawl-space assessment answer?
It should turn scattered symptoms into a prioritized decision. At minimum, the homeowner should leave understanding:
- what conditions were observed and where;
- which measurements or patterns support the conclusions;
- the likely source of water, humidity, damage, or movement;
- what needs prompt attention, what can be monitored, and what is optional;
- the logical order of work when repairs can be phased;
- which type of qualified contractor is appropriate for each next step.

When should a crawl-space problem be evaluated quickly?
Move faster when the condition is active, changing, or potentially unsafe. Examples include standing water, an active plumbing leak, water near electrical components, visibly sagging or damaged framing, rapid floor movement, strong persistent odors, or a major change after a storm.
The EPA explains that the key to mold control is moisture control and that wet materials should be dried promptly. Its homeowner guide to mold and moisture also advises correcting the water source rather than treating visible growth alone. What is the bottom line for Raleigh-area homeowners?
Be an internet warrior—just be a disciplined one. Learn the language. Save useful sources. Ask for measurements. Challenge recommendations that are not connected to evidence. But do not let a confident search result, video, or AI response make a property-specific decision it cannot verify.
The goal is not to know less. It is to use what you learn online to get a clearer answer from the person standing in the actual crawl space.

Can online research diagnose my crawl space?
Online research can explain symptoms, materials, and repair methods, but it cannot establish the moisture source, wood condition, drainage pattern, or repair priority in your specific home. Those conclusions require evidence from the property.
Are crawl-space videos and AI tools useful?
Yes. They can help you learn vocabulary, compare methods, and prepare questions. They should not be treated as a diagnosis because they cannot verify concealed conditions or take measurements at your home.
Why do repair companies give different opinions about the same home?
Companies may interpret symptoms differently, emphasize systems they install, or combine optional improvements with urgent work. Compare the evidence, priority, and expected result behind each scope—not only the price.
What should I ask before approving crawl-space work?
Ask what was observed, what measurement supports it, what is causing it, what happens if you wait, which work is essential, which work is optional, and how the repair addresses the cause.
When should a crawl-space problem be evaluated quickly?
Seek prompt evaluation for active water, plumbing leaks, sagging or visibly damaged framing, electrical contact with water, strong persistent odors, or a rapid change after a storm. Do not enter an unsafe space yourself.
